Responsibilities: As a Transport Driver you will drive a tanker
truck (11,400 gallon capacity) to pick up propane at the supply
point (e.g. refinery, pipeline terminal, storage facility) and
deliver it to area AmeriGas facilities. The driver will make four
to five pick-ups and deliveries per day, driving an average of 500
miles per day and working up to 14 hours per day. Approximately 80
percent of the driver's time is spent driving or waiting in line at
the supply point. Duties include, but are not limited to: • Drive
the tanker truck to pick up propane at the refinery and deliver to
area AmeriGas facilities; approximately 45 minutes is required to
load or unload the truck. • Attach terminal hoses to the truck
connections to pump propane into the tanker. • Use permanent hoses
attached to the filling ports or the hoses stored in the truck to
unload the tanker. The hoses stored on the truck come in two sizes:
20 feet long, three inches in diameter; and 19 feet long, 1½ inches
in diameter. • Perform twice daily truck inspections. • May climb
ladders at some AmeriGas facilities to check gauges at the top of
the bulk tanks. What's In It for You? • Out 2-3 days a week • 17
